The NH Machiavelli enjoys a totally privileged, strategic position in Milan, in the Porta Venezia area, only a couple of minutes away from the main railway station and from the financial hub and city shopping centre.
Therefore, the Machiavelli provides an excellent base for those wishing to savour the abounding tourism opportunities offered by the Lombard capital such as the Duomo, the Alla Scala theatre, the Brera Gallery, as well as prestigious shops and the exuberant vitality, that only a metropolis like Milan can offer.
The property is a hotel of novel conception. A modern functional structure in which every space fulfills the highest expectations of comfort and elegance, from the welcoming lobby up to the Caffè Niccolò restaurant served by an independent entrance, which in the summer season may host guests on a terrace overlooking the internal, Japanese-style garden.
Furthermore, for all your business needs, the hotel features comprehensive meeting and conference facilities.

The hotel offers 100 spacious rooms, including 16 singles with King-size beds, 17 twins, 55 doubles, 9 corner rooms, and 3 doubles for disabled guests.
All rooms are soundproof and comfortably furnished in warm, contemporary style. They all feature air-conditioning, hairdryer, colour and satellite TV, radio, direct-dial telephone (in the bathroom, too), Internet connection, mini bar, trouser press and safe.
Smoking and non-smoking rooms are also available.

How to reach Hotel NH Machiavelli
By car
From the A8 Milano-Varese/aeroporto Malpensa, A9 Milano-Como, A4 Milano-Venezia highways:
Go along the Turin-Venice Torino-Venezia link road until the 11th km, take the exit for viale Zara/Sesto S. Giovanni and follow the signs to the town centre, go along viale Fulvio Testi then go straight along viale Zara as far as piazzale Lagosta, for a total of about 7.5 km. Go 3/4 of the way around the roundabout and turn right into via Pola. Go straight along via Pola for 500 m, go straight along via Luigi Galvani for 300 m and cross piazza Duca D'Aosta (main railway station on the left), go along via Vitruvio for 300 m. Turn left into via L. Settembrini, cross piazza Cincinnato (300 m) and continue until you reach via Lazzaretto (200 m). The NH Machiavelli is located at number 5 (on the corner of via Finocchiaro Aprile). The time required is about 20 minutes and the distance is 9.5 km from the viale Zara exit.
From the A7 Milano-Genova highway:
Take the western bypass (tangenziale ovest) in the direction of the A1 Milano-Bologna highway, enter the eastern bypass (tangenziale est) in the direction of the A4 Milano-Venezia and continue until the Lambrate exit at the 3rd km. Go along via Rombon, following the signs to the city centre as far as piazza M.Titano (800 m). Go through the tunnel and go down via Porpora as far as piazzale Loreto (1.6 km). Once in the square turn left towards corso Buenos Aires (700 m), going towards the centre of the town. Turn right into via Vitruvio and after about 20 m turn left into via Settembrini. Go straight on, cross piazza Cincinnato (300 m) and you will reach via Lazzaretto (200 m). The NH Machiavelli is at number 5 (on the corner of via Finocchiaro Aprile). The time required is about 10 minutes and the distance is 4.5 km from the Lambrate exit.

By train
The hotel is 300 m from the Milano Centrale railway station.
By airplane
From the Milano Malpensa airport: a bus service leaves every 20 minutes for the Milano Centrale railway station, located 300 metres from the hotel. The taxi ride is about 45 minutes.
From the Linate airport: a bus service leaves every 30 minutes for the Milano Centrale railway station, located 300 metres from the hotel. The taxi ride is about 15 minutes.
From the Orio al Serio airport: a bus service leaves every 30 minutes for the Milano Centrale railway station, located 300 metres from the hotel. The taxi ride is about 50 minutes.
